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

feat: add IaC sysdig alerts #725

Merged
merged 27 commits into from
Oct 30, 2024
Merged

feat: add IaC sysdig alerts #725

merged 27 commits into from
Oct 30, 2024

Conversation

jon-funk
Copy link
Collaborator

@jon-funk jon-funk commented Oct 25, 2024

Description

Adds a suite of sysdig alerts, version controlled via terraform and managed state via NRS object storage

How Has This Been Tested?

Please describe the tests that you ran to verify your changes. Provide instructions so we can reproduce. Please also list any relevant details for your test configuration

  • Tested deployment, and pipeline
  • verified emails recieved from alerts

Checklist

  • I have added tests that prove my fix is effective or that my feature works
  • New and existing unit tests pass locally with my changes

Further comments


Thanks for the PR!

Deployments, as required, will be available below:

Please create PRs in draft mode. Mark as ready to enable:

After merge, new images are deployed in:


Thanks for the PR!

Deployments, as required, will be available below:

Please create PRs in draft mode. Mark as ready to enable:

After merge, new images are deployed in:

@jon-funk jon-funk added invalid This doesn't seem right pipeline change Change that updates the pipeline not ready Not ready for review, WIP, do not merge. labels Oct 25, 2024
@jon-funk
Copy link
Collaborator Author

Team wiki entry for updating channels/alerts incoming shortly

@jon-funk
Copy link
Collaborator Author

Note: the if conditional in the github action will be uncommented once approved

@afwilcox afwilcox removed invalid This doesn't seem right not ready Not ready for review, WIP, do not merge. labels Oct 28, 2024
@jon-funk
Copy link
Collaborator Author

wiki entry: https://github.com/bcgov/nr-compliance-enforcement/wiki/SysDig#updating--adding-alerts

Copy link

sonarcloud bot commented Oct 29, 2024

@afwilcox afwilcox merged commit 45a39eb into release/noble-sea-lemon Oct 30, 2024
15 checks passed
@afwilcox afwilcox deleted the CE-314 branch October 30, 2024 02:34
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
pipeline change Change that updates the pipeline
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ants